Lee, James Melvin – Bureau of Education, Department of the Interior, 1918
Probably the chief advantage which a democracy has over other forms of government and society lies in the fact that it constitutes within itself a great school, stimulating its citizens to the acquisition of information about public affairs and training them in intelligent thinking on all subjects of public-interest. In this school the public…

Houston, Charles A.; Hoyer, Robert W. – 1975
This report correlates the college transfer mathematics courses in the Virginia community colleges with their counterparts at 13 state four-year colleges and universities. Data were collected by examining four-year college catalogues, correlating this information with course descriptions in the Virginia Community College Curriculum Guidelines…
